Arbitration

Barristers at Selborne Chambers accept appointments to sit as arbitrators, as legal assessors (advisors to arbitrators), primarily concerning disputes in Chambers’ core practice areas and via Chambers’ arbitration service, Selborne Chambers Arbitration (“SCA”).

Selborne has extensive arbitration experience in domestic and international arbitration. Some members regularly act as arbitrators and all members appear as advocates in arbitrations, both institutional and ad hoc.

In addition to accepting appointment under the Selborne Chambers Arbitration scheme, members of Chambers accept appointments whether as sole arbitrator, party-appointee, or chair, not only in arbitrations seated or held in London but also in those being conducted overseas, having a foreign seat or, where appropriate, applying foreign law. Chambers’ arbitrators are familiar with the rules and procedures of the ICC, LCIA, CIArb, DIFC, QICCA and SIAC in addition to those under the UNCITRAL Rules. Members of Chambers will also act as expert to the tribunal in matters of English law.
